Vinny & Byrne do their own version of Mystery Science Theater as they discuss the documentary "Murder In The Front Row" in real time. The documentary encapsulates the birth of thrash metal in america from the bay area, and how it brought thrash music to the masses. The PODcore boys discuss the impact the music had on them as well as the bands, and unsung heroes who help put it all together and start the metal movement in the good 'ole U.S. of A.
